I finally got to do some driving in my vrs this weekend. Picked it up last monday with 16,000 miles on it, so is nicely loosened up.

First impressions are great. I have owned alot of cars, and I am really happy with this one - more so than I can remember with just about any other purchase (with the odd exception). It just does it all so well. The ride is very comfortable for a small car, yet it handles really well. The performance is just so accessible - effortless. The interior although not to all tastes, is really well laid out and the seats are very comfortable. I have hardly used any fuel over the first 150 miles I have done !!

I have exactly the same worries about remapping. It goes so well without it I'm just not convinced it is the best thing to do.

Anyway - I have promised to keep this one for 2 years to my wife so I hope it carries on like this...
